Nociceptor activation and pain

Philosophical Transactions of the Royal Society of London. B, Biological Sciences, 1985
Abstract This paper reviews advances in our knowledge on the physiological properties of human nociceptors and their capacity to signal pain. Conventional microneurography was used in combination with intraneural microstimulation in subjects who estimated the magnitude of pain from nociceptor stimulation.

Nociceptors of the Joint with Particular Reference to Silent Nociceptors

2007
This chapter summarizes recent research on mechanisms by which diseased joints become painful. Joints are supplied with sensory AΒ, Aδ and C fibers.
